For context, the dividend yield on the benchmark FTSE Nareit All REIT Index in 2022 ranged from 3.1% to 4.3%. The ... Private REITs. A private REIT is neither registered with the SEC nor available for trade on stock exchanges. 5 If you invest in one, be prepared to forget you had that money. They’re usually illiquid—a fancy term that means an investment can’t be easily turned back into cash. Private REITs typically offer higher dividends than publicly traded ones. According to data provided by National Real Estate Investor, private REIT dividend yields have traditionally been in the 7% to 8% range, while public trusts have returned between 5% and 6%. Non-traded REITs are a lesser-known category. While they aren’t listed on stock exchanges, non-traded REITs are required to register with the SEC and are subject to more oversight than private REITs.

Real estate investment trust (REIT) is a collective investment scheme that invests primarily in real estate. It is managed by an SFC-licensed manager and its units are listed on The Stock Exchange of Hong Kong Limited (SEHK).
